On September 13, Telegram and the TON Foundation announced at the Token2049 event in Singapore that the two parties had officially reached a partnership and integrated the self-hosted encryption wallet "TON Space" launched by TON. In other words, all Telegram wallet users will be able to use TON Space from now on, and the next step is to roll out the service to Telegram users around the world in November this year.

At the Token 2049 event, Telegram CTO John Hyman and TON Foundation President Steven Yun attended a speech. Steven Yun said that future projects built on the TON blockchain will have priority to participate in Telegram's advertising platform Telegram Ads. Steven even said that "Telegram will only be integrated with the TON blockchain."

With more than 800 million users worldwide, the popular social messaging software Telegram has instantly become a gold mine for the TON ecosystem. TON has made no choice between "focusing on making its products or services the best" and "relying on marketing to expand users." It can be said that it emerged to serve Telegram from the beginning. Although there were many obstacles in the process, it will definitely be a matter of time before these 800 million people are finally exposed to the TON ecosystem.

In addition, Steven also set expectations after the integration of the two at the event, "It is estimated that about 30% of Telegram's active users will enter the TON blockchain in the next 3-5 years, laying the foundation for wider adoption of Web3 technology. "

Indeed, what Steven said makes sense. In the past, the biggest difficulty in acquiring new users for blockchain projects was not the difficulty of using it, but the high barrier to entry for users. However, TON can basically seamlessly integrate with Telegram. Taking the payment function as a simple example, Telegram users can send TON and BTC directly to friends in the chat room. The usage is similar to WeChat payment. This simple operation is the key point for Web3 to break out of the circle.

Closed three years ago due to regulatory issues, the new version of TON and Telegram join hands again

In 2017, Telegram developed a blockchain project called Telegram Open Network (the first generation TON). As an L1 public chain that has been favored many times by Telegram, TON initially appeared on the market with the goal of establishing an entire The blockchain ecosystem also issued Gram, a native encrypted asset.

In 2018, TON conducted an initial coin offering to specific investors and raised a total of US$1.7 billion. At that time, this figure became the second largest ICO fundraising project in history.

In October 2019, the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) suddenly announced that it had taken "emergency action and obtained a temporary restraining order" against TON. The SEC believes that Gram is an unregistered security under the Securities Act of 1933 and therefore cannot be sold to U.S. investors. Of the $1.7 billion raised last year, more than $400 million came from U.S. investors. Therefore, the SEC has the authority to issue immediate injunctions, quickly obtain evidence, return ill-gotten gains, prohibit them from selling or distributing more Grams, and impose civil penalties.

Telegram appealed the next day, arguing that once TON was launched, GRAM would be just a currency or commodity, no different from gold and silver. However, the SEC still insisted that Telegram had violated U.S. securities laws.

Investors were originally looking forward to "the Telegram blockchain network will be launched as usual without being affected by regulatory incidents," but the reality was completely different from what they imagined.

The key point in time for the separation of Telegram and TON was May 8, 2020. Unable to wait for Telegram to resolve regulatory issues, Telegram’s technology partner TON Labs first released a forked version called Free TON. TON Labs CEO Alexander Filatov emphasized that in order to be consistent with the original To distinguish it from the TON version, this forked version is called Free TON, the token name is "Ton Crystals" and Telegram did not participate in the release of TON Labs . This is essentially an independent release of open source software.

At that time, the token supply limit was also 5 billion, 85% will be distributed free of charge to TON partners and users, 10% to developers, and 5% to verification nodes.

Soon after, on May 13, 2020, Telegram founder Pavel Durov publicly announced that he was abandoning the blockchain project TON and was fined US$18.5 million by the SEC. "In the past two and a half years, we have spent a lot of manpower and energy researching the underlying technology of the blockchain, which far exceeds Bitcoin and Ethereum in terms of speed, scalability and other performance. What I have achieved for TON today We are very proud of the progress, but now we have to announce the closure of TON due to interference from the US court.”

Regarding GRAM, Durov explained in a letter to investors that the reason why the U.S. court banned TON is because TON is not allowed to sell its token GRAM to investors in the United States and even from around the world. Durov stated this in the letter It's ridiculous. "Unfortunately, we, 96 percent of the world's population, must listen to policymakers chosen by only 4 percent of Americans."

Finally, Durov also announced that other cryptocurrency projects will use TON's name and technology in the future. He said at the time that Telegram "will not" take any way to support them in the future.

In May 2021, a developer community called NEWTON replaced Telegram to continue research on TON. NEWTON was spontaneously established by the Telegram community and is independent of Telegram. It was renamed the TON Foundation (TON Foundation) in 2021. TON was also founded by The original Telegram Open Network was changed to The Open Network, and the encryption token on the chain also changed from Gram to Ton Coin.

However, although Durov has previously stated that he will no longer participate in any technical development of TON, he still strongly supports the TON Foundation and the TON blockchain, and has further actively participated in cooperation to promote the development of the project.

On April 12, 2022, the TON Foundation officially announced the official launch of its first ecosystem fund "TONcoin Fund", and received cooperation from institutions such as Huobi Incubator, KuCoin Ventures, MEXC Pioneer Fund, 3Commas Capital, TON Miners and Kilo Funds. Exchange's $250 million investment. The fund will be used to fund financing, incubation, hackathons, educational programs and grants for TON-based development projects.

Same as TON but different from his father, what is the key to Durov going from being initially unfavorable to "must support"?

Even though TON uses the same abbreviation as the project originally founded by Durov, it no longer stands for Telegram Open Network. Instead, when TON, abandoned by Durov, was moved to developer governance, the team not only repurposed the project, but also called it an "open network" with tokens using Ton Coin rather than the native tokens of the Telegram TON project. Currency Gram.

Although initially, Durov was dismissive of the project, even warning followers that TON had absolutely nothing to do with Telegram. But since last year, Durov has obviously changed his attitude.

On August 23, 2022, Durov publicly praised the domain auction conducted by TON. He believed that Telegram might also launch an auction market for user names, groups and channel links, and tried to use TON (The Open Network) as the market in the future. the underlying blockchain. Then on December 7 last year, Telegram officially issued an announcement stating that users can have a Telegram account without a SIM card and log in using the anonymous number supported by the blockchain provided on the Fragment platform.
